Title: The Innovations of Albert S. Chou
Introduction
Albert S. Chou is an influential inventor based in Monte Sorreno, CA, known for his contributions to technology. With a focus on advancements in computing, he has secured a patent that showcases his innovative spirit and technical expertise.
Latest Patents
Chou holds a patent for a Fixed Disk Drive, which signifies his role in enhancing storage technologies. This invention has contributed to the efficiency and capacity of data storage systems, reflecting his ability to identify and solve critical challenges in the field.
Career Highlights
Chou is associated with the renowned Xerox Corporation, a company known for its innovations in printing and document technology. His work at Xerox has allowed him to explore and implement cutting-edge technology, furthering the company's reputation as a leader in the tech industry.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Chou has collaborated with talented individuals such as Donald V. Daniels and Terence H. West. These partnerships have fostered an environment of creativity and problem-solving, empowering the development of groundbreaking technologies.
